• From what I understand, most tempdb operations already take place purely in RAM, till they get too big to fit there. Temp tables and table variables both work that way. Maybe transaction log actions on temp tables involve disk I/O, I'm not sure. If they do, they could be moved into a RAM version of the tran log just for tempdb and that might improve performance by some tiny amount on really busy systems.

    - Gus "GSquared", RSVP, OODA, MAP, NMVP, FAQ, SAT, SQL, DNA, RNA, UOI, IOU, AM, PM, AD, BC, BCE, USA, UN, CF, ROFL, LOL, ETC
    Property of The Thread

    "Nobody knows the age of the human race, but everyone agrees it's old enough to know better." - Anon